Deleting past scheduled items
i am try to delete items i have scheduled in 2006 2005 and 2004 all at once.
how do i do this? and how do i put my settings to delete items from the past? |
Deleting past scheduled items
Use autoarchiving to remove past entries. To remove them manually, reset your calendar view to a table view (such as events) sort by the date column, select your range of dates and press delete.
